include_directories(${CMAKE_SOURCE_DIR} ${CMAKE_SOURCE_DIR}/src/libkst ${CMAKE_SOURCE_DIR}/src/libkstmath ${CMAKE_SOURCE_DIR}/src/libkstapp ${KDE3_INCLUDE_DIR} ${QT_INCLUDE_DIR} )

########### next target ###############

set(kstextension_dirfile_PART_SRCS
    dirfile.cpp
    dirfilesave_i.cpp)

KDE3_ADD_UI_FILES(kstextension_dirfile_PART_SRCS dirfilesave.ui)

KDE3_AUTOMOC(${kstextension_dirfile_PART_SRCS})

KDE3_ADD_KPART(kstextension_dirfile ${kstextension_dirfile_PART_SRCS})

target_link_libraries(kstextension_dirfile kstbase kparts ${GETDATA_LIBS})

install(TARGETS kstextension_dirfile 
	LIBRARY DESTINATION lib/kde3
        ${INSTALL_TARGETS_DEFAULT_ARGS})

########### install files ###############

install(FILES  dirfilesave.png DESTINATION share/icons/hicolor/22x22/actions/)
install(FILES  kstextension_dirfile.rc DESTINATION share/apps/kst)
install(FILES  kstextension_dirfile.desktop DESTINATION share/services/kst)
